One of the most common parasitic infections in the world is malaria. Although preventable and curable, malaria can have a devastating effect. According to the World Health Organization (WHO), there were 249 million cases in 2022, with 94% of them occurring in Africa. There are…

TWiP 232: Lives of Wolbachia 〰️ TWiP reviews the cellular lives of Wolbachia, a gram-negative bacteria that infects many arthropods and filarial nematodes with very different outcomes – parasitism or mutualism. Hosts: Dickson Despommier, Daniel Griffin, and Christina Naula. 📺…
